What should you consider in Indonesia?

Telkomsel, XL and Indosat are different networks. Compare the names listed on the actual plan if you will visit several islands. A national network name does not prove you will have reception on every boat route, beach or inland location.

HolySim vs Airalo

For Indonesia, HolySim costs less than Airalo at all four fixed allowances. The named networks also differ: HolySim lists Telkomsel, XL and Smartfren; Airalo lists 3 and Indosat. That is a relevant difference to consider before buying for a trip across several islands.

HolySim vs Holafly

For Indonesia, this compares HolySim’s fixed data allowance with Holafly’s unlimited phone use. Both name Telkomsel and XL. A fixed HolySim plan costs less for light or moderate usage; Holafly may suit heavy daily use.

HolySim vs Saily

For Indonesia, HolySim costs less at 5, 10 and 20 GB and also offers 50 GB as a fixed plan. Saily stands out for automatic top-ups and 24/7 chat. HolySim names its network partners; Saily does not do so on the country page checked.

HolySim vs Nomad

HolySim costs less for Indonesia at the four allowances compared. At 20 and 50 GB, however, Nomad gives you 45 days instead of 30. That longer validity can matter more than the price difference if you travel around Indonesia for longer.
